GPC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

682 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Genuine Parts (GPC)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$10.7B — up 13% from $9.52B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 73 funds opened new GPC positions and 35 closed out — a net gain of 38 holders — while 239 added to existing stakes and 244 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Royal London Asset Management, adding an estimated $314M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$48.2M.
